Vehicle Collides with Unoccupied Home in Colorado Springs

Jan 22, 2025 at 8:25 PM

In a recent incident that unfolded during the afternoon hours, emergency responders from the Colorado Springs Fire Department rushed to the scene following a vehicle collision. The accident occurred in an area under development near the intersection of Woodmen and Black Forest Road. This unexpected event led to significant concern for both local authorities and nearby residents.

Details of the Incident

On a crisp autumn day, a vehicle veered off course and collided with an unoccupied new residence located along Templeton Gap Road. Emergency personnel arrived promptly at the 7400 block of White Lodge Point to assess the situation. Fortunately, the driver sustained only minor injuries and was transported to a nearby medical facility for evaluation. Structural stabilization experts were also present to ensure the safety of the impacted building. This swift response helped mitigate potential hazards and provided reassurance to the community.
